I found a hidden treasure!
Yesterday I was going through the boxes in the garage for the garage sale and found a box I haven't looked in since about 1980. In it was my 5 year diary for the years 1968 thru 1972! I was 13, 14, 15, 16, 17, and 18 through out those years.
I looked through it awhile then called my Mom, lol. I read her excerts and we talked for nearly 3 hours! We are so excited because the diary is like a family history.
It had the births of my brother and sister and the day Mom told us she was pregnant and when she made her maternity dresses. It had things like when we got a new horse and what we named it. When the neighbors and my aunts and uncles passed away and when a great aunt visited and when some of my grandparents passed away. It had a history of when Dad would leave out on the truck and when he would come back home and when we would go fishing and camping and what each of us 5 girls did on our birthdays and what I got for Christmas every year. Lots of times I listed how much money I had and what I did with my money and when I would babysit and how much I would make. One day I babysat for a family of 3 kids for nearly 12 hours and I made $5.00 and I was thrilled,lol!
Mom and I decided I would write out a copy on the computer of each day for the 5 years and give each one of my sisters a copy of it leaving space on each day for them to add any events or things that they and Mom remembered and possibly adding any years but Mom thinks I'm the only one out of all of us that kept a diary. I would just copy each page on the scanner but nearly every page and date I talk about some boy and how I'm in love with him, lol. I sure was boy crazy!
I just wanted to share the wonderfull treasure I found.
